Dynamic Construction Site Layout Planning Optimization using Genetic Algorithms
Abstract
Construction site layout planning is one of the basic planning tasks in engineering projects as it plays a major role in reducing project costs, and enhancing productivity and occupational safety on construction sites. Due to the complex nature of construction projects and the multiple factors involved in site layout planning, it was necessary to develop a framework capable of overcoming some of the shortcomings of existing site layout planning models and obtaining more efficient solutions in terms of meeting the physical and qualitative requirements for planning.
This research aims to develop a mathematical model for optimizing the multi-objective dynamic construction site layout planning using one of the approximate optimization techniques, which is genetic algorithms in order to generate optimum planning solutions during the construction phases of the project that achieves the various planning objectives of reducing costs and maximizing productivity and safety. The site layout planning problem has been formulated in the form of a mathematical model, and then implement this model as a multi-objective genetic algorithm applied in MATLAB environment.
The results of testing the proposed site layout planning model on the case study, proved the efficiency of this model and its ability to generate optimum site planning solutions according to the imposed planning objectives and constraints.
